Orthoptists concentrate on the diagnosis and monitoring of troubles with eye movement and sychronisation, such as imbalance of the aesthetic axis, binocular vision issues, and pre/post surgical care of strabismus clients.


Orthoptists are educated to deal with people making use of optical aids and eye exercises. [] Orthoptists are mainly discovered working along with ophthalmologists and eye doctors to co-manage binocular vision therapy, aesthetic area loss management and accommodative therapy. They typically do common eye and vision testing together with computerised axillary testing. All three kinds of expert carry out testings for usual ocular problems affecting kids (such as amblyopia and strabismus) and adults (such as cataracts, glaucoma, and diabetic person retinopathy).

That graph has a large letter or sign on top, and each line of letters/symbols gets gradually smaller sized the farther down the chart you go. This component checks how well you see in each different section of your field of view in each eye. It can detect spaces or unseen areas that shouldn't be there.


Your service provider will evaluate each eye on its very own and after that both eyes with each other. In this component, your service provider analyzes the conjunctiva, a thin, clear membrane layer that covers the white location (sclera) of your eye find here and the inside of your eyelids. The ocular adnexa consists of all the parts of your eye and face that aren't the eyeball itself.


Looking at it with a slit light allows your service provider see if it's in great condition. Looking at it via a slit lamp gives an extra detailed, close-up view of these frameworks.

Your expert will certainly take a look at the lens's quality and structure. Your specialist will take a look at the optic disk (where the optic nerve affixes to the eyeball) and the optic cup (the bowl-shaped point at the center of the disk). They'll additionally check the cup-to-disk proportion. If the ratio is low, it can indicate a higher danger of problems like ischemic optic neuropathy.
